Brief summary
New derivatives of 8-aminoalloxazine were obtained and studied by physico-chemical methods. The virtual assessment of the biological properties of the synthesized compounds carried out using the PASS Online program allows us to expect with a high probability the effects associated with selective exposure to riboflavin-dependent enzyme systems, enzymes of xenobiotic metabolism, as well as the presence of respiratory-analeptic activity in substances.
